Output e59bda84f148b69a2e3420d42fc74718fde3a110bd25c24ee1a0f7c8772566af:1

value
730559019
script pubkey
OP_0 OP_PUSHBYTES_20 e3a7a8c842f67adb5be342243c53e44ea7d2eef7
address
ltc1quwn63jzz7eadkklrggjrc5lyf6na9mhhlv6kj3
transaction
e59bda84f148b69a2e3420d42fc74718fde3a110bd25c24ee1a0f7c8772566af
spent
true